#408f40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#408f40 is composed of 25.1% red, 56.1%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.2%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 38.2% and a lightness of 40.6%. #408f40 color hex could be obtained by blending #80ff80 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#408f40 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#408f40 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#408f40 has RGB values of R:64, G:143,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 4230976.
